  • 2007-1-14 As of today, any pages that could be confused between CSU Chico and Butte College (such as campus buildings), will have a specific prefix: CSU Chico or Butte College. For example, if there happened to be a building of the same name on each campus named Science Building, the titles would then be CSU Chico Science Building and Butte College Science Building. If there are no conflicts between campuses, then the prefix may be omitted unless greater clarity is desired. Hopefully this will make the headers on these sorts of pages convey all the right information.

16 August 2006

  • Implemented the simple macro MapThis. This takes a Chico address (not any other address!) and outputs plain text and a link. It will only accept a street number and a street name! The macro format is:

 [[MapThis(801 Main St)]] 

  • Implented proper thumbnailing support. Now users can upload a photo as an attachment and have it thumbnailed and aligned appropriately. Do not use the Thumbnail macro. Instead, use ThumbPlus — this is the new version. Usage follows:
Format: [[ThumbPlus(imagefilename, width, "caption", right or left)]]
Example: [[ThumbPlus(wikisomebeautifulimage_one.jpg, 200, "This is a really pretty image", right)]]
